🔥 Coleman TM8Y Review (LX Series Price & Efficiency Guide)
The Coleman TM8Y Review highlights a dependable 80% AFUE two-stage gas furnace designed for homeowners seeking improved comfort at an affordable price. Positioned in the LX Series lineup as a mid-efficiency model, the Coleman TM8Y combines two-stage heating with a variable-speed ECM blower to provide smoother temperature control than traditional single-stage furnaces.
🔹 Coleman TM8Y Overview
| Feature |
Details |
| AFUE Rating |
80% |
| Heating Type |
Two-Stage |
| Blower Motor |
Variable-Speed ECM |
| BTU Input |
60,000 – 120,000 |
| BTU Output |
48,000 – 96,000 |
| ENERGY STAR® |
No |
| Installed Cost |
$3,800 – $4,800 |
| Warranty |
10-Year Parts (Registered), Lifetime Heat Exchanger |

🧾 Warranty Coverage
Coleman backs the TM8Y with:
Base Warranty: 5-Year Parts, 20-Year Heat Exchanger
Registered Warranty: 10-Year Parts, Lifetime Heat Exchanger
5-Year Unit Replacement Warranty
Registration is required to access the extended warranty benefits.
This coverage is strong within the mid-efficiency furnace category.

❓ Frequently Asked Questions
Is the Coleman TM8Y a high-efficiency furnace?
No. With 80% AFUE, it is classified as a mid-efficiency furnace.
How much does the Coleman TM8Y cost installed?
Installation typically ranges from $3,800 to $4,800 depending on home size and labor conditions.
Is the TM8Y ENERGY STAR certified?
No. It does not meet ENERGY STAR efficiency requirements.
Is the Coleman TM8Y two-stage?
Yes. It features a two-stage burner combined with a variable-speed ECM blower.
How long does the TM8Y last?
With proper maintenance, it can last 15–20 years or more.
